What is a Crush and How Does it Feel?
A crush is typically characterized by intense attraction to someone, accompanied by feelings of longing and desire. This attraction often has a mix of physical and emotional components. The sensation of having a crush can lead to excitement, nervousness, and even anxiety. When you think about the person you are crushing on, you might experience a rush of adrenaline, leading to physical symptoms such as a racing heartbeat and butterflies in the stomach. These feelings can be wonderfully exhilarating yet confusing as you grapple with your emotions.
Common Psychological Reactions to Having a Crush
Psychologically, crushing on someone can lead to an array of cognitive and emotional responses. Often, you might find yourself daydreaming about the person, replaying conversations, or analyzing their every move. This hyper-focusing can skew your perception, making you idealize them. Furthermore, the neurochemical aspects of attraction involve dopamine and oxytocin, which create feelings of happiness and attachment, leading to a heady mix of emotions.
The Physical Signs of Attraction and Interest
When you have a crush, your body may react in noticeable ways. Signs can include:
- Increased heart rate when around the person
- Feeling fidgety or nervous in their presence
- Uncontrollable smiles or laughter during interactions
- Heightened sensitivity to their words and actions
Recognizing these physical signs can be a first step in acknowledging your feelings, enabling you to explore the nature and depth of your crush.

How to Distinguish Between Infatuation and Genuine Interest
Infatuation often involves intense emotions that can be fleeting, while genuine interest is typically grounded in deeper understanding and compatibility. Paying attention to how long these feelings last and whether they affect your daily life can help you determine the nature of your crush. Genuine interest tends to lead to wanting to know the person better, beyond physical attraction.

How to Deal with Unreciprocated Feelings
Unreciprocated feelings can be particularly disheartening. It’s important to acknowledge your emotions without self-judgment. Allow yourself to feel sad or disappointed, but set boundaries to avoid fixation. Engaging in healthy conversations about your feelings with friends or a therapist can be beneficial.

Body Language: Signals that Show You’re Interested
Non-verbal communication is just as important as verbal exchanges. Pay attention to body language cues, both yours and theirs. Leaning in, maintaining eye contact, and mirroring their gestures can indicate interest and help build rapport.
